Commit Graph

30311 Commits

Author SHA1 Message Date
tigercat2000
e56750481c Multilingualism
This commit adjusts the speech parsing system to allow for an infinite
number of languages to be present in the same message. You can
transition freely between any language you are able to speak simply by
putting it's language key in the middle of the sentence.

Honestly, this was a massive pain in the ass, and there's probably still
broken stuff, even though I've spent around 8 hours testing and refining
this.
2018-11-24 00:22:05 -08:00
variableundefined
6ab84c09eb Merge pull request #10310 from datlo/strangeobjectfix
Replace "illegal" and "weapon" in strange objects names
2018-11-23 22:19:32 +08:00
variableundefined
8c0bb8f1a4 Merge pull request #10320 from TDSSS/block_fix
Fixes check_block runtimes
2018-11-23 21:47:58 +08:00
TDSSS
5ed3d6b39c Added block_chance on living level 2018-11-23 13:00:04 +01:00
AzuleUtama
ff92a43bcf cleaned it up a bit 2018-11-23 10:45:37 +00:00
AzuleUtama
4bea51027b Overall fix for projectile falloff
Aims to fix the overall issue of damageless projectiles not working under the new falloff code.  Also fixed some weird indentation in the original version of the range() code.
2018-11-23 10:23:38 +00:00
Kyep
7d0ddfeec9 reverted to my way of doing it, sans Uncrossed 2018-11-22 18:59:04 -08:00
Kyep
90ff882149 use Ansari snipped and SEND_SOUND macro 2018-11-22 18:34:13 -08:00
Kyep
3fe6c8b019 switch to tg method, override /mob/dead/forceMove, revert all previous component changes 2018-11-22 18:26:36 -08:00
Kyep
49c3bb4a38 Fixes squeaking 2018-11-22 12:45:01 -08:00
datlo
8070b9f87a change real names of some strange objects 2018-11-22 12:38:27 +00:00
variableundefined
80ddd0e8a3 Merge pull request #10303 from AzuleUtama/syndiecigsMaintloot
Add Syndicate Cigarettes to Maintenance Loot
2018-11-22 19:20:54 +08:00
variableundefined
b2ce6e5829 Merge pull request #10300 from AlAtEX/IPC-repair
Adds a Medkit for IPCs
2018-11-22 11:53:11 +08:00
variableundefined
33c4c3385a Merge pull request #10308 from AzuleUtama/laserTagGuns
Made laser tag guns work again
2018-11-22 10:01:31 +08:00
AzuleUtama
0332e946f6 Made laser tag guns work again
dear god what have i done
2018-11-22 01:25:16 +00:00
variableundefined
214cf7b12e Merge pull request #10288 from datlo/basicsofCQC
Snake, try to remember some of the basics of CQC.
2018-11-22 08:53:26 +08:00
datlo
12f6413417 SPACING SKREEE 2018-11-22 00:27:52 +00:00
variableundefined
4a01a631f4 Merge pull request #10297 from Kyep/adm_fixes
Adds Hellhound, minor outfit tweaks
2018-11-22 08:24:18 +08:00
variableundefined
d0f6c0f5b3 Merge pull request #10294 from Eniraz/helmet-toggle-button
Hardsuit helmet toggling button
2018-11-22 08:22:21 +08:00
AlAtEx
7e0c1862b5 Added machine first aid kits to cargo order under medical 2018-11-21 18:15:05 -05:00
AlAtEx
e6740168d9 Added machine first aid kit code 2018-11-21 18:14:40 -05:00
AlAtEx
4025abbbbb Revert, The Sequel 2018-11-21 16:05:41 -05:00
AlAtEx
c2be8936eb Revert 2018-11-21 15:59:39 -05:00
datlo
5ef666f0f5 oops forgot to remove a line
durrr
2018-11-21 17:27:29 +00:00
datlo
f1ada4fefa big commit changes in desc
Added missing spacings
Added attack logging
Raised cost to 9 TC, made it tator and nukies, added to surplus, allowed
nukies to have gloves of north star, and updated description
Added a check preventing usage of CQC with gloves of north star
Fix a bug where attacks would not go through if a combo was done but the
target was critically injured (regular attacks now done instead)
Changed disarm logic, now always hits for 5 damage and use regular
disarm logic for disarming/pushing
Replaced "Big Bossed" attack verb by "neck chopped" and "gut punched"
because nofunallowed
2018-11-21 17:18:32 +00:00
Eschess
86c229b6e0 changes loc for forcemove, also removes pointless blockhair flag 2018-11-21 16:29:10 +01:00
AzuleUtama
9f0c127d9a Add syndi cigs to maint loot
Since an item classed as legal can only be gotten on the uplink right now.
2018-11-21 11:21:24 +00:00
variableundefined
c3f86a0629 Merge pull request #10289 from MrKicker/master
Adds more words to ai vox
2018-11-21 13:16:09 +08:00
MrKicker
1775469e81 Removed happied
not a word
2018-11-20 21:10:45 -05:00
Michael C
f542396d11 Update drinks.dm 2018-11-20 21:05:41 -05:00
Michael C
bbba753001 Update boxes.dm 2018-11-20 21:04:49 -05:00
Michael C
f1d52f58fe Update support.dm 2018-11-20 21:04:09 -05:00
Michael C
920c1ec71e Update job.dm 2018-11-20 21:03:35 -05:00
Fox McCloud
fca03ff254 Merge pull request #10032 from variableundefined/SqueakComponent
Add in squeak component & refactor bikehorn, mouse to use it.
2018-11-20 18:38:42 -05:00
Kyep
39b6725555 hellhound + minor tweaks 2018-11-20 15:19:19 -08:00
variableundefined
842b487980 Add disposing signal listening 2018-11-21 07:19:11 +08:00
variableundefined
62cf837af2 Merge pull request #10258 from AffectedArc07/nttc-additions
NTTC Fixes And Features
2018-11-21 07:15:39 +08:00
MrKicker
f9068a5082 Adds more words
ADDS:
anomaly
assistants
avenge
avenging
avenged
bluespace
infection
infections
infect
infected
chaplain
chemistry
cremate
cremated
cremating
cremation
crematorium
criminal
criminals
critical
demon
disease
diseased
diseases
everything
fatal
fatalities
fatality
fatally
generator
generate
generated
gravity
injured
larva
lobby
magistrate
magic
magician
magicians
morgue
officers
offline
plasmaman
plasmamen
revenant
scientist
scientists
server
servers
shadowling
shadowlings
shadow
tech
technician
technicians
unknown
unknowns
virologist
virus
viruses
2018-11-20 18:04:37 -05:00
variableundefined
5e380d9c03 Merge pull request #10292 from AzuleUtama/chameleonSuitFixes
Fix for chameleon suit allowing you to pick an undefined object
2018-11-21 06:54:47 +08:00
Eschess
aba20b9b58 typecasts link_sui and readds helmet autodeploy 2018-11-20 23:26:51 +01:00
AffectedArc07
352998419d Adds admin logging to regex enabling 2018-11-20 21:42:19 +00:00
Eschess
1f614665f3 toggling combat mode via the helmet button actually works now 2018-11-20 19:38:53 +01:00
MrKicker
b3021bdd3c Removed and modified some words
Removed:
anime and animes
happying
jap, japan, and japanese
neared
seld

Changed:
blowed to blown
maked to made
sadded to saddened
sadding to saddening
2018-11-20 13:07:50 -05:00
AzuleUtama
221f1a3833 Spacing
spacing
2018-11-20 16:20:31 +00:00
AffectedArc07
8acf94b7e2 Tiger fixes because ansari said so 2018-11-20 15:42:12 +00:00
AzuleUtama
d667df47eb Fix for chameleon suit allowing you to pick an undefined object
Stop chameleon suit allowing you to choose a undefined suit with a placeholder texture, as well as making the first option in the list a random color for each individual suit.
2018-11-20 15:19:54 +00:00
datlo
e0037ffefe space activated
mama mia stop the copy pasta
2018-11-20 15:03:38 +00:00
Certhic
6850d3d27a multitool fixes 2018-11-20 14:21:25 +01:00
variableundefined
6f96aa0a5c Merge pull request #10280 from TDSSS/silencer-tech
Moved silencers, gave them their own folder + tech origin
2018-11-20 19:19:02 +08:00
datlo
65286d7830 Adds the CQC manual to nukie uplinks 2018-11-20 03:51:52 +00:00